A garage door opener is a small motor doing a heavy job, and when it fails it almost never fails for no reason. In Olathe homes we see the full range: openers that hum but won't lift, units that reverse halfway down, remotes that have quietly stopped reaching the wall, and the dreaded dead-silent opener that won't respond to anything. Because Olathe spans decades of construction — from long-settled streets to brand-new builds — we work on everything from aging chain-drive units to the latest quiet belt-drive and smart Wi-Fi openers, and we carry parts for all of them.

The mistake we most want Olathe homeowners to avoid is replacing a whole opener when the real problem is a worn part. A failed logic board, a stripped trolley gear, a burned-out capacitor, a misaligned safety sensor, or a broken garage spring can all make an opener act dead while the motor itself is perfectly fine. Our techs diagnose the actual point of failure first, then tell you straight whether it's a quick fix or a true end-of-life unit — never the other way around.

Opener Problems We Fix Across Olathe

Every major brand and drive type, residential and commercial.

Stripped Drive Gears

The plastic main gear is the most common opener failure — the motor spins but the door won't move. We replace the gear or carriage and have you running again.

Remotes & Keypads

Dead remotes, unresponsive wall buttons, and exterior keypads that stopped working — reprogrammed, re-synced, or replaced on the spot.

Safety Sensor Faults

A blinking light and a door that won't close usually means misaligned or dirty photo-eye sensors near the floor. We realign and test the reversal.

Logic Board & Motor

Burned capacitors, fried control boards, and failed motors. We test the electronics before condemning the unit so you don't overpay.

Spring-Strained Openers

A broken or weak torsion spring forces the opener to lift a door it was never meant to carry. We fix the spring so the motor stops failing.

Smart & Wi-Fi Openers

MyQ and app-connected units that lost connection, won't pair, or stopped responding to the phone — diagnosed and restored.

Signs Your Olathe Opener Needs a Tech, Not a New Unit

Before you assume the whole opener is shot, watch for these — most point to a repairable part:

  • Motor runs or hums but the door doesn't move (classic stripped gear)
  • Door reverses partway down or won't close, with a blinking opener light
  • Loud grinding, clicking, or new rattling during operation
  • Remotes work intermittently or only from a few feet away
  • Door feels heavy and slams down by hand — a spring or balance issue straining the motor
  • Wi-Fi or app connection drops repeatedly on a smart opener
